Flowable composite introduced

Dec. 4, 2006
New product is radiopaque, fluoride releasing and has a nominal particle size of 0.7 microns.

WATERTOWN, Massachusetts--Pulpdent Corporation has released Flows-Rite Multi-Purpose Flowable Composite and Veneer Cement.

Flows-Rite is a 68 percent filled, light-cured, flowable esthetic restorative, veneer cement, liner, base, and fissure sealant with handling characteristics and esthetic properties used by dentists. Four-syringe kits are available at the manufacturer's price of $37.50.

The product is radiopaque, fluoride releasing and has a nominal particle size of 0.7 microns. It cures with any light.

The product is available in shades A1, A2, A3, A3.5, B2, B3, C2, C3, bleach white, and ShadeFusion. ShadeFusion is a chameleon-like color that blends shades and reflects adjacent hues to create a natural esthetic. It is ideal for incisal repairs and veneer cementation.

The product is sold in packages containing 4 x 1.5 gm syringes of Flows-Rite, 20 applicator tips, instructions, and MSDS sheet. Pulpdent also offers an A-Shade Assortment Kit with one syringe each A1, A2, A3, and A3.5; and a Rainbow Assortment Kit with one syringe each A2, B2, C2, and ShadeFusion, plus 20 applicator tips.

Flows-Rite is available from a dental dealer.
